Overview
MAX6033CAUT25+T from Maxim Integrated is a precision 2.5V series voltage reference IC with ±0.10% initial accuracy, 40ppm/°C max temperature coefficient (−40°C to +125°C), and 200mV max dropout voltage. It delivers ultra-low 16µVP-P (0.1Hz–10Hz) noise and 40µA quiescent current, making it suitable for high-resolution ADC/DAC biasing in automotive-grade instrumentation.

Technical Context
The MAX6033CAUT25+T employs laser-trimmed thin-film resistors and post-package trimming to achieve ±0.10% initial accuracy and 40ppm/°C tempco over −40°C to +125°C. Its bandgap core ensures low-noise operation and excellent long-term stability (40ppm/1000hr).
This 6-pin SOT23 series reference features dual-output architecture (OUTF/OUTS) for Kelvin sensing, enabling precise regulation under varying load conditions. It operates from 2.7V to 12.6V input, supports 15mA output sourcing, and maintains 0.001mV/mA load regulation at +25°C.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Output Voltage | 2.500V ±0.0025V at +25°C - tight tolerance enables direct interface with 14-bit+ DACs without calibration. |
| Initial Accuracy | ±0.10% - guarantees output deviation ≤ ±2.5mV at room temperature, reducing system-level trimming effort. |
| Tempco | 40ppm/°C max (−40°C to +125°C) - limits drift to ±125µV over full automotive range, critical for stable sensor front-ends. |
| Noise (0.1–10Hz) | 16µVP-P - low flicker noise preserves SNR in precision measurement chains feeding 20-bit ADCs. |
| Dropout Voltage | 200mV max at 1mA - allows operation from 2.7V supply while maintaining 2.5V output, ideal for low-voltage battery systems. |
| Quiescent Current | 40µA typical - minimizes standby power in always-on automotive modules and portable instrumentation. |
| Load Regulation | 0.001mV/mA at +25°C - ensures <10µV shift per mA load change, essential for dynamic current-sense applications. |
| Capacitive Load Stability | Stable with 0.1µF to 100µF - accommodates wide-range bypassing for EMI suppression without oscillation risk. |
Pinout & Package
MAX6033CAUT25+T is housed in a RoHS-compliant 6-pin SOT23 package (U6FH+6 outline, land pattern 90-0175), optimized for space-constrained automotive PCBs and industrial sensors.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1, 3 | I.C. (Internally Connected) | Not externally usable - internal connection only; must remain unconnected on PCB. |
| 2 | GND | Analog ground reference - requires low-impedance connection to system AGND plane for noise immunity. |
| 4 | IN | Positive supply input - accepts 2.7V–12.6V; decoupling with 0.1µF ceramic capacitor near pin improves line rejection. |
| 5 | OUTF | Force output - drives load; must be shorted to OUTS near device for Kelvin sensing and optimal regulation. |
| 6 | OUTS | Sense input - monitors feedback point at load; enables remote sensing to cancel trace IR drop in precision systems. |

FAQ
What is the maximum capacitive load the MAX6033CAUT25+T can drive while remaining stable?
The MAX6033CAUT25+T is stable with output capacitive loads ranging from 0.1µF to 100µF. This wide range allows designers to select appropriate bulk and bypass capacitance for EMI filtering and transient response without risking oscillation - a key advantage over shunt references that require strict capacitor limits. The MAX6033CAUT25+T maintains phase margin across this entire range due to its internal compensation design.
Does the MAX6033CAUT25+T support Kelvin sensing, and how is it implemented?
Yes, the MAX6033CAUT25+T implements Kelvin sensing via separate OUTF (force) and OUTS (sense) pins. OUTF supplies current to the load, while OUTS connects directly to the load's reference node to close the feedback loop. Shorting OUTF to OUTS near the device ensures accurate local regulation; routing OUTS to the remote load point cancels voltage drop in PCB traces, preserving reference accuracy. This architecture is integral to the MAX6033CAUT25+T's 0.001mV/mA load regulation spec.
What is the guaranteed temperature coefficient specification for MAX6033CAUT25+T over the full automotive range?
The MAX6033CAUT25+T is guaranteed to maintain ≤40ppm/°C temperature coefficient over the full −40°C to +125°C automotive operating range. This value is specified in the Electrical Characteristics table under "Output Voltage Temperature Coefficient" for MAX6033C grade at TA = −40°C to +125°C. It reflects worst-case drift across temperature cycling, ensuring predictable performance in under-hood and transmission-control applications.
Can the MAX6033CAUT25+T operate from a 3.3V supply while delivering a stable 2.5V output?
Yes, the MAX6033CAUT25+T supports input voltages from 2.7V to 12.6V and has a maximum dropout voltage of 200mV at 1mA load. With a 3.3V supply, the minimum headroom required is 0.2V, leaving 0.8V margin - well within specification. At 3.3V input, the MAX6033CAUT25+T delivers full 2.5V output with guaranteed accuracy, noise, and regulation performance across temperature.
